While a perfect LSAT score is a worthy goal, you should know that only 0.1% of LSAT test-takers achieve it. That’s a clear indication of just how hard the LSAT is. The LSAT is scored between 120 and 180.

You shouldn’t expect yourself to score high on your very first LSAT because you’ve likely never encountered these types of questions before. Don’t let your score discourage you or define your potential. The diagnostic is only a tool to help you understand … See more It’s best to take a timed test to get an accurate base score before you begin studying. Doing an untimed test gives you an advantage you won’t have during test day! If you feel like taking a full timed test will be too draining to … See more While you’ll most likely skip a few questions on your LSAT diagnostic test, do your best to actually solve the questions before moving on. By trying to answer the questions, you’re already building your own problem-solving … See more Using your diagnostic LSAT test score, figure out how far you are from your target LSAT score. If you’re only a few points off, you likely won’t have to spend as much time studying for the LSAT as you would if you were 15 or more … See more When you take the test, ensure you keep a mental or physical note of which sections and questions you found the most challenging and which ones were the easiest.
